How
loved, honored, & cherished do you feel by those closest to you?
Here’s
a very revealing exercise: Think of the 10 people you spend the most time
with in your life – whether family, friends, or co-workers. On a scale
of 1 to 10, with 10 being tops, how loved, honored, & cherished do you
feel in the presence of each of these people?
Of
course, you can also ask, “How loved, honored, & cherished do each
of them feel in my presence?” but that is the focus of our next column.
It
is remarkable how quickly this simple exercise shows us how well – or
not well – we are being loved by those in our inner sphere of living.
Can you see the enormously undermining impact of low ratings on your
happiness in life?
Each
of us, in our constant desire and struggle to move higher & higher in
our living & awareness, needs love that is nurturing, accepting,
adoring, empowering, sustaining, and dependable. This is not simply
a nice thing to hope for. It is your spiritual right to be loved,
honored, & cherished by those around you. Accept this as one of
your love standards in life.
For
each person you rated as loving, honoring, & cherishing you at a 9 or
10, rejoice that you are being loved so well. Tell them about this
exercise. Thank them for their love.
For
each person you rated 8 or below ask yourself - without blaming the person
or yourself – “How can I help this relationship move towards a 10?”
Thinking this way is loving yourself and opening your life to the
awareness that it is your spiritual right to be loved, honored, &
cherished.
“Yes,
but what about the close family member who doesn’t love, honor, or
cherish me? I can’t just ditch my family.” Of course not,
but you can step outside of your time-anchored relationship with that
person and set new standards and expectations. You can speak with an
honesty infused with love that sees the higher vision of the love you
deserve. You can tell them how your heart feels. In loving
truthfulness, you will find others awakening with you and because of
you. It’s not about blame. It’s about love expansion –
for everyone. You are simply being called forth to be the love
teacher – helping others, even a close family member, learn how to love
you at a higher level.
“Yes,
but what about the co-worker who doesn’t treat me well. I can’t just
go ask that person to start loving me.” Well, actually, you can!
You don’t have to use the word “love,” but you can engage that
person heart to heart. You can find a private moment and tell that
person that you would like to discuss how you both could advance your
relationship so both feel better about each other. This calls for
courage on your part. But the alternative is a continuing life of
not being well loved.
“Yes,
but what if I talk to the family member or co-worker and they don’t
care?” Continue to love them from your highest selfhood, but
be aware that you deserve to be surrounded by people who love, cherish,
& honor you. Your higher consciousness of love – loving
yourself without blaming others – will move those who don’t love you
well to a further distance in your life and those who do love you to a
close embrace. And bring new love givers into your life as well.
This is the path that opens your life to the love you deserve – and the
big secret is that you, by yourself, have the power to create this higher
love around you. Welcome to the heart of Love!
